Method and device for producing nanomaterial structures
Original language description
The present invention relates to a method and device capable to form a nanomaterial structure on a receiver by transfer of nanomaterial from a donor film. In some embodiment, the transfer can be provided by laser induced forward transfer, more preferably by blister based laser induced forward transfer. The method further comprises a simultaneous scanning of the donor film or the receiver so that, a computer driven means for moving the receiver and the donor film can form high precision nanomaterial structure. In a preferred embodiment, the simultaneous scanning can be provided by an imaging laser generating high harmonic waves which are detected by a detector. In yet another embodiment, the receiver and/or donor film can be further scanned by a broadband light source(s). In a preferred embodiment, imaging laser and/or light source(s) are emitting polarized light to determine orientation of the nanoparticle deposited on the receiver and forming the nanomaterial structure.
